Drug Resistant Tuberculosis in PNG and the Western Province TB program.

PNG is one of only 14 countries classified by the WHO as having the triple high burden of TB, MDR-TB, and TB-human immunodeficiency virus (HIV) co-infection. Three hotspot regions have been identified in the country including the Gulf, National Capita District (NCD), and Western Province. In Western province, the problem has been further compounded by high levels of drug-resistant TB, with evidence of primary (person to person) transmission of resistant strains, particularly in Daru of South Fly District.

The Western Province TB program, led by the WPHA, with support from partners has led to commendable success, with an increasing recognition of Daru as a ‘Centre of excellence’ in the programmatic management of DR TB with outstanding treatment outcomes for patients.

Role Purpose

The purpose of the operations Coordinator role is to oversee the day-to-day management of the Daru based logistics support team, lead WP project asset management and to provide support to the WP team. The role will report directly to the Team Leader – Operations and be part of an experienced team of managers, clinicians and public health professionals based in Daru, Port Moresby and Melbourne , providing inputs in WP. The role works to ensure efficient operation of the Burnet Daru office and the timely and efficient delivery of support services to the team.

The Operations Coordinator will be responsible for assisting the Team Leader – Operations to ensure the efficient management and implementation of all operational, logistical, financial, and administrative tasks in line with Burnet Institute PNG policies and practice.

Reporting and supervision:

The Operations Coordinator position will be supervised by and report directly to the Team Leader - Operations, based in Daru. This position has 6 direct reports, Logistics Coordinator, Logistics Officer, two Drivers and two office attendants. During the absences of the Team Leader – Operations the Operations Coordinator is expected to act in the role.
